Oldham Athletic 0-2 York City

Oldham Athletic suffered a 2-0 defeat against York City in their English National League match at Boundary Park. York City took the lead in the 24th minute with a goal from Malachi Fagan-Walcott. York City continued to push forward and doubled their lead in the 38th minute through a goal from Ollie Pearce.

Before Fagan-Walcott’s goal, Reagan Ogle was booked in the 22nd minute for a foul. Additional bookings were given to Callum Howe and Ashley Nathaniel-George in the 42nd and 46th minutes, respectively, for fouls. York City’s win saw them move up to second place in the English National League standings, while Oldham Athletic dropped to fifth.

Oldham Athletic made a tactical substitution at halftime, replacing Alex Reid with Mike Fondop-Talum. York City also made changes, substituting Ashley Nathaniel-George for Josh Stones in the 61st minute. Further substitutions were made by both teams, but York City continued to control the game. Emmanuel Monthe and Harrison Male received yellow cards in the 65th and 91st minutes, respectively, for fouls.

York City sealed their victory with no further goals scored in the second half. The win extended York City’s good form, while Oldham Athletic will look to regroup and bounce back in their upcoming fixtures.
